Documenting Hands-On Education: A Homeschool Program on the Farm

I was photographing a homeschooling location where education goes far beyond a classroom. I love documenting places like this because the moments are real. There’s no staging when a child is carrying feed, opening a gate, or learning how to care for an animal. These environments create authentic stories, and that’s exactly what I aim to capture: natural light, real interactions, and honest moments that reflect the heart of the space.
